Teacup and saucer, soft-paste 'duck egg' porcelain, the cup with a white, green tinged translucency, the saucer with a green translucency; cup standing on a straight sided foot rim curving into rounded sides, slightly flaring at lip; ear-shaped loop handle; saucer on a straight sided foot rim with rounded sides; both painted below the lip with single pink roses alternating with single blue convolvuli, with small green leaves, and a single pink rose in the centre.
